How to store leftover pancakes:

You can store your leftover cooked and cooled pancakes in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 4-5 days.

Because of the cool temperature and the lack of humidity,your pancakes will loose their soft doughy texture the longer they sit in your fridge.

You can also store your leftover gluten-free pancakes in plastic airtight storage baggies in the fridge for the same amount of time.

You can also keep your cooked and cooled pancakes in one of the above mentioned containers at room temperature for up to 48 hours.

Keeping the pancakes at room temperature gives you a better chane of keeping that soft, doughy texture to when you are ready to devour more pancakes!

How to store leftover strawberry champagne sauce:

I highly recommend storing leftover smashed strawberry champagne sauce in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 1 week.

You can also store this champagne sauce in a freezer-safe conatiner in the freezer once your sauce has cooled off ot room temperature.

The champange sauce is good stored in your freezer for up to 6 months!

How to reheat your leftovers:

Reheating gluten free pancakes:

To reheat your leftover pancakes, place your pancakes on a microwave-safe plate with no more than 2-3 pancakes placed on the plate on top of one another.

Microwave your pancakes on high power for15-45 seconds, depending on your microwave, the number of pancakes you are reheating at one time, and how hot you like your pancakes.

Once your pancakes are warmed back up to your liking, place a clean kitchen towel over top of the pancakes to keep them warm while you are rehating more pancakes or the champagne sauce!

Reheating Strawberry Champagne Sauce:

To reheat your decadent pancake sauce, simply place your smashed strawberry sauce in a microwave-safe dish with a lid loosely fitted on top where hot air can still escape.

Microwave on hig hpower for 30-60 seconds, stir the sauce, and check to see how hot it is.

If you need your pancake sauce to be a bit warmer, microwave the sauce for another 30-45 seconds, stirring once more, before checking to see the temperature before eating.

This sauce can get very hot very quicky! Don't burn yourself!

Yield: 12

Cook Time: 20 minutes

Total Time: 20 minutes

These gluten-free pancakes with smashed strawberry champagne sauce are one for the books! The pancakes are light and fluffywith a touch of coconut sweetness.

Ingredients

  • ½ cup of BHHY's 1-Minute GF Bisquick Mix
  • 4 eggs
  • ¼ cup milk or cream
  • 3 tablespoon coconut oil
  • For the Champagne Sauce:
  • 2 cups strawberries, tops taken off and halved
  • ¾ cup granulated sugar
  • ½ teaspoon lemon juice
  • 1 teaspoon cornstarch
  • 3 tablespoon champagne, or orange juice!

Instructions

  1. In a large skillet over low heat, melt the coconut oil until melted. Place melted oil in a large mixing bowl.
  2. Add the eggs and milk and whisk until fully combined. Add in the 1-Minute Bisquick Mix and stir until smooth and there are no lumps.
  3. Turning the heat up on the large skillet to medium-low, place ⅛ cup fulls of the batter into the already coconut-oiled skillet. Let cook for 2-3 minutes on the first side, check to see that it is golden brown and flip to the other side until the same color is seen.
  4. Using a spatula, remove each pancake from the skillet. Keep cooked pancakes warm by wrapping them in a warm towel on a plate.

Notes

While the pancakes are cooking, make your strawberry champagne sauce:
In a medium saucepan, combine the smashed strawberries (smash with a potato masher or the bottom of a bowl!), sugar, cornstarch, lemon juice, and champagne. Place over medium heat until boiling. Turn down to a simmer and allow to simmer uncovered for 10-15 minutes or until reduced to about half of original volume. Remove from heat and allow to cool for a few minutes before smothering your pancakes with the sauce!
